Job Description

A growing manufacturing organization is seeking a Syteline ERP Analyst / Developer with proven Syteline 10 experience to help support and scale a business-critical ERP environment. This role offers a strong mix of hands-on development, functional analysis, and cross-functional partnership, making it a great fit for someone who enjoys solving real operational problems and working closely with the business. You will play a key role in supporting and enhancing Syteline 10, helping teams across finance, supply chain, inventory, and operations improve how they use the system. This position is highly visible and well suited for someone who thrives in fast-paced manufacturing environments, can navigate complexity, and wants to make a direct impact on production and process performance.
